Faculty Civil Engineering and Geosciences Department Hydraulic Engineering Date 2011-09-05 Abstract This paper presents the development of a semi-probabilistic method for armour layer design of rubble mound breakwaters, which is based on the use of safety factors. The objective is to introduce an approach that is both attractive to designers and sufficiently reliable when a high degree of uncertainty is involved in the design process. The main focus of the analysis is the calibration and appropriate use of the safety factors, which is the key element for a reliable result.
